The Critical Role of Licensing and Registration in Online Gaming Ecosystems
In the dynamic landscape of online wagering, the foundation of consumer confidence rests on robust licensing standards. Licensed operators adhere to strict protocols that safeguard players’ funds, enforce fair gaming practices, and uphold anti-money laundering directives. Developing a transparent certification process is crucial for regulatory authorities aiming to mitigate illegal operations and for players seeking security in their betting activities.
